We study initial algebras of determinantal rings, defined by minors of
generic matrices, with respect to their classical generic point. This approach
leads to very short proofs for the structural properties of determinantal
rings. Moreover, it allows us to classify their Cohen-Macaulay and Ulrich
ideals.
